dry ice and alcohol.

SCCA will let you use a cool can of 1-qt or smaller in Prepared and above (SOLO-II).

it can work at AX where the run times are short, or if you have a nonrecirculating fuel system (carburetors - which means you're probably in at least Prepared class in a /4). in a recirculating system, all the fuel in the tank runs through the loop eventually.

the big heat increase comes from the right heat exchanger (if the early pump is in the stock location) and - in the case of the /4 - by running aaround the fuel loop in the engine compartment.

typical gasoline boiling point is 140F - think about that the next time you're on the track with a 120F track temperature on that 100F day...

the road race cars sometimes use small radiators (heat exchangers, really...) in the airstream.

i recall a trip i took in the '72 from Phoenix to San Diego when we hit the hotel ice machine and packed the entire gas tank area with cubed ice, and repeated the process at every fuel stop. car ran fine with no vapor lock issues, but it was pretty well sorted by then anyway. but cold fuel is denser and the more *properly metered* fuel you can get in, the more power youve got available...

For many years Jaguar used a fuel cooler - the fuel line was plumbed into a small canister surrounding one of the air conditioning lines. Not really applicable for making more power (turn the AC off, stupid IPB Image ) but interesting.

In colorado at altitude there is less cooling than at sea level.

ALOT of guys run fuel coolers in road racing out here.
I never finished my car (which blew up) but was briefly a part of a rotary SCCA spec-7 class out here.

the fuel cooler was absolutely Required on a hot rotary motor. NO one ran without.

I know of a colorado 3.6 914 with a front oil tank. He was having quite a bit of fuel problems and vapor lock. He believes it was because his front (hot) oil was pre-heating his fuel tank. He added a radiator fuel cooler in his front trunk. A small scoope under the floor pan picks up air and then exhausts back down the bottom after it exits his cooler.

stopped his fuel problems.

Years ago in SCCA, one of our competitors decided to use a cool can. Basically a coil inside a can filled with dry ice, mounted in the engine compartment. Great idea, but the venting of the can (Carbon Dioxide vapor) was to close to the intake of the carbs. On pre-grid, the fumes could be readily seen and when he went to start the car for the race....no go IPB Image He was known thereafter as the "Ice Man".

The real problem is that boiling-point (vapor-lock) is a function of two things - pressure and temperature. The higher the pressure the higher the boiling point. So, in Denver fuel will boil at a lower temperature than it will in LA. That's why people at high altitude have vapor-lock problems in the summer when people at sea-level usually don't.

I get a kick out of the west-coast contingent who always say "914's don't vapor lock". Well, if they were to drive one up a 9,000 ft mountain pass on a hot summer day they'd change their story. Unless it had a front-mounted fuel pump. (front mounted pump increases pressure in the lines and raises the boiling point)

No really, with carbs the fuel flashing off (going from liquid to vapor) absorbs heat from the surrounding material (the carb), which probably does a helluva job of cooling the fuel in the float bowl, but little for the fuel in the lines.......I recommend keep your car floored at all times to keep a nice stead flow of cool fuel comin' to the carbs. IPB Image

I actually had my Holley Bugspray ('68 Baja bug) carb literally turn into a solid block of ice going from San Diego to Denver.....had to divert one of my heater pipes to the air cleaner to keep it running [insert smilie freezing his ass off here].

Hmmmm.....anyone running carbs in colder climates have problems with carbs freezing?
